Output 856627caa69cb17139584a693667c518d9fa2f9b078b3b6597abfebd58667f0d:29

value
530888
script pubkey
OP_0 OP_PUSHBYTES_20 74be313a79da977668a3257b5eb855a717a85459
address
bc1qwjlrzwnem2thv69ry4a4awz45ut6s4ze9gp6q8
transaction
856627caa69cb17139584a693667c518d9fa2f9b078b3b6597abfebd58667f0d
spent
true